I don't understand what you mean when you say, "My posting for Dick Clark has been moved to the page #151-200 rather than #539 between original posting date of 4/19 and today, 4/20/12". When you post a flower, it is at the top of the list. When someone else comes along and posts another, yours gets bumped down the list and the new one takes its place. With a recent death of a very popular celebrity, the flowers roll in quickly.

Find A Grave has no paid staff. The only person that could possibly adjust the date field on a flower is me. No one else has access to the database at that level and I assure you that I did not adjust the date on any of your flowers.
